Problem 42917. Nth roots of unity
First, find the n nth roots of unity. eg if n = 6, find the n distinct (complex) numbers such that n^6 = 1.
https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Root_of_unity
Second, raise each root to the power pi (.^pi).
Third, sum the resulting numbers and use that as the output.
